Code § 34-3-11","heading":"Judges Not to Practice Law.","body":"Any judge of a court of record in this state who practices law in any of the courts of this state, or of the United States, or who renders any professional services or gives any legal advice, must on conviction be fined in such sum as the jury or court trying the same may assess, not less than $100 nor more than $1,000.","path":["Title 34 Professions and Businesses.","Chapter 3 Attorney-at-Law.","Article 1 General Provisions."],"source_url":"https://alison.legislature.state.al.us/code-of-alabama?section=34-3-11","current_through":"Act 2026-611","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-09-03T14:01:52Z","sha256":"625752c7efc52ff23ea624e9f0f5c1c1c87b890f9e3d95afa435af2b9c008e7e","source_id":"us-al","stale":false,"prev":"us-al/ala.-code-34-3-10","next":"us-al/ala.-code-34-3-12"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
